Marin Journal
Thursday, August 21, 1913
Page 4
Controller A. B. Nye died on Tuesday from pneumonia after a series of paralytic strokes.
Nye was born in Stockton on October 25, 1853. He received his education in the East and entered newspaper work there. Later he came to California, and for fourteen years edited the Oakland Enquirer. In January, 1903, he gave up newspaper work to become secretary to Governor Pardee. He was appointed State Controller on November 23, 1906, and was reappointed on January 7, 1907. In 1910 he was nominated and elected by both Democratic and Republican parties for the term ending in 1915. He was regarded as the most able Controller the State had ever had.
